Robert (Bob) Burnham holds degrees from Western Michigan University and Indiana University, studying with Thomas Beversdorf, Keith Brown, Donald Yaxley, Gerald Sloan, Robert Whaley and Russell Brown.

His performance experience ranges from Opera to Funk to The Ringling Brothers Barnum and Bailey Circus and the Guy Lombardo Orchestra. He currently performs with The Dallas Wind Symphony, The American Chamber Brass, Slideshow Trombone Ensemble and is in demand as a freelance performer in all genre. Other activities include adjudicating, conducting and arranging for a variety of ensembles.

Mr. Burnham is a member of the Conn-Selmer Artist/Educator roster.
